COMMONWEALTH OF AUSTRALIA (Civil Aviation Regulations 1998), PART 39 - 107 CIVIL AVIATION SAFETY AUTHORITY

SCHEDULE OF AIRWORTHINESS DIRECTIVES

 


Oxygen Systems

 

AD/OXY/17 Smoke Hood Inspection 2/98

Applicability: AIR LIQUIDE Smoke hood type 15-40 F installed on any type of aircraft with the following lot numbers and are not further identified with a “R1” on the label:

Requirement: 1. Inspect and remove from service all type 15-40 F smoke hoods installed on aircraft and identified by the lot numbers above.

 

2. Smoke hoods identified above are not to be fitted to any aircraft.

 

Note: DGAC AD 97-088(AB)R1 refers.

 

Compliance: 1. Unless previously accomplished, no later than 16 July 1998.

 

2. As of the effective date of this airworthiness directive.

 

This airworthiness directive becomes effective on 29 January 1998.

 

Background: The DGAC has been informed that some visors on the smoke hoods, identified by the lot numbers detailed become opaque (white) within a few minutes following the opening of the vacuum package. In order to eliminate the potential risk presented by these hoods, this airworthiness directive requires all smoke hoods identified to be removed from service.
